Position Summary The Branch Physical Security Architect is a senior leadership role responsible for the end‑to‑end architectural direction of physical security technologies across a banking retail branch network. As the principal technical authority for this engagement, you will define standards, lead multi‑workstream programmes, and serve as the primary point of contact for the client's executive leadership.
This role provides strategic oversight, not hands‑on implementation, across new branch builds, renovations, technology refreshes, and large‑scale security programmes. You will guide engineering teams, integrators, and vendors toward consistent, compliant, and resilient security outcomes while ensuring alignment with enterprise security architecture and regulatory requirements.
You will work cross‑functionally with the client’s PMO, IT Network Engineering, Facilities, Risk & Compliance, and external partners, serving as the single authoritative voice on branch physical security architecture.

Key Responsibilities Architectural Leadership & Standards
Define, document, and govern architectural standards for physical security systems across all branch environments
Develop and maintain the branch physical security technology roadmap aligned with corporate security strategy and regulatory frameworks
Ensure consistent design principles, technology standards, and best practices are applied bank‑wide
Executive Engagement & Program Leadership
Serve as the primary liaison to the client’s C‑Suite, providing regular technical briefings and status updates – daily and weekly cadence
Lead the Physical Security workstream within large‑scale programmes (new builds, renovations, technology refreshes) in close partnership with the PMO
Define project scope, sequence deployments, manage risks, and ensure security deliverables align within overall programme timelines
Multi‑Workstream Coordination
Lead and provide technical direction to architects and engineers across multiple concurrent workstreams
Coordinate across IT infrastructure, Facilities, Construction, Security Operations, and other workstreams to deliver cohesive solutions
Review and approve design documents, architecture diagrams, and bills of materials
Solution Design & Integration Oversight
Serve as design authority for branch physical security systems: CCTV/video surveillance, intrusion detection and alarms, access control, duress and life‑safety systems
Oversee integration architecture connecting security systems with IT infrastructure, alarm monitoring, and identity management platforms
Balance security requirements, user experience, and cost‑effectiveness across the branch network
Vendor & Technology Governance
Drive evaluation, selection, and standardisation of security technologies and vendor solutions across the portfolio
Manage relationships with external integrators and service providers, ensuring adherence to technical requirements and quality standards
Enforce solution consistency across multiple vendor products, platforms, and service contracts
Risk Management & Governance
Chair or participate in design review boards to oversee branch security architecture decisions
Contribute to risk assessments and mitigation planning for new implementations and change events
Provide senior‑level support during critical incidents, guiding engineering teams toward root‑cause resolution and long‑term fixes
Continuously evaluate emerging physical security trends, regulatory changes, and threat intelligence to evolve branch security strategy
Qualifications & Technical Skills
PSP (Physical Security Professional), CPP, CISSP, or Certified Security Architect certification
8+ years of progressive experience designing and implementing physical security systems across multi‑site, branch, retail, or distributed facilities environments; financial services experience strongly preferred
Deep expertise in CCTV/VMS, alarm and intrusion detection, electronic access control, and duress/life‑safety systems – architecture, integration, and network dependencies
Proven ability to develop and enforce enterprise‑scale technical standards and reference architectures across numerous locations
Strong understanding of networking as it applies to security systems: IP connectivity, PoE, VLANs, LAN/WAN, bandwidth considerations
Demonstrated experience leading technical workstreams within large‑scale programmes, including stakeholder management at the executive level
Familiarity with alarm monitoring workflows, security operations centre models, and escalation/incident response frameworks
Experience coordinating across IT, Facilities, Security Operations, PMO, and external vendors in a matrixed environment
Proficiency with documentation standards: architecture diagrams, design specifications, as‑built records, and standards documentation
Available to work full‑time EST hours and start within 7 days of offer
Preferred Qualifications
Banking or financial services industry experience, particularly with regulatory and compliance requirements (FFIEC guidelines, audit frameworks, UL alarm certification standards)
Familiarity with major physical security platforms in banking: Lenel access control, major VMS and camera systems, alarm monitoring and integrated physical security management software
Understanding of how physical security intersects with cybersecurity frameworks and enterprise risk policies
Prior experience in a senior security architecture role with multi‑site delivery responsibility
Exposure to 24x7 security operations, monitoring centres, or command centre‑based support model
